Abstract

The utility model discloses a composite electric stimulation physiotherapy sheet, which comprises a substrate, a conductive gel sheet, a traditional Chinese medicine patch and an electrode piece, wherein the substrate is made of non-woven fabrics; the conductive gel sheet is arranged on the bottom surface of the substrate, and the center of the conductive gel sheet is provided with a hollow area; the Chinese medicine is stuck to the hollowed-out area and is suitable for carrying Chinese medicine ointment; when the conductive gel sheet is attached to the body surface of a patient, the traditional Chinese medicine is attached to the body surface of the patient; the electrode piece is positioned on the top surface of the substrate, and the electrode piece is electrically contacted with the conductive gel sheet. According to the composite electric stimulation physiotherapy sheet, the mode of combining electric stimulation physiotherapy with traditional Chinese medicine application can obviously improve the treatment effect aiming at focus. In addition, the traditional Chinese medicine patch can be conveniently removed and replaced, and the physiotherapy sheet can be repeatedly used, so that the combination has a strong clinical application value.

Background
An electric stimulation physiotherapy sheet is a medical apparatus for stimulating human body surface by electric current, promoting blood circulation, relieving pain and enhancing body function. The principle of the device is that the change of current is utilized to generate electric pulses with different frequencies and intensities to stimulate nerve endings or muscles and cause physiological reactions, thereby achieving the effect of electric stimulation physiotherapy.
The main components of the electro-stimulation physiotherapy sheet are a gel electrode piece and a lead. The gel electrode plate is a part attached to the surface of a human body, and has the function of transmitting current to the human body and keeping good contact. The lead is a part connecting the gel electrode plate and the power supply or the controller, and has the functions of transmitting current and adjusting parameters of the current. In the related art, most of the electro-stimulation physiotherapy sheets are designed by adopting simple gel electrode sheets, and the gel electrode sheets can only produce a single physical physiotherapy effect and have relatively poor effect.

The following describes the composite type electro-stimulation physiotherapy sheet according to the embodiment of the present utility model in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Referring to fig. 1 to 5, the composite electro-stimulation therapy patch according to the embodiment of the present utility model includes a substrate 10, a conductive gel sheet 20, a Chinese medicine patch 30 and an electrode member 40.
Specifically, the substrate 10 is a nonwoven material. The substrate 10 is made of non-woven fabric material, has the characteristics of softness, ventilation and the like, and can increase the comfort level and the fitting level of the physiotherapy sheet.
The conductive gel sheet 20 is disposed on the bottom surface of the substrate 10, and has a hollow area H20 in the center. The conductive gel sheet 20 is made by mixing conductive powder with gel, has good conductivity and adhesiveness, can effectively transfer current to the human body, and maintains stable contact of the physiotherapy sheet with the human body. The hollow area H20 is a circular or other hollow area formed on the conductive gel sheet 20, and its diameter or size can be adjusted as required, which is used to provide space for the patch 30.
The Chinese medicine patch 30 is arranged in the hollow area H20 and is suitable for carrying Chinese medicine ointment; when the conductive gel sheet 20 is applied to the body surface of the patient, the Chinese medicine patch 30 is applied to the body surface of the patient. The Chinese medicinal patch 30 is a medical material which can be applied on the body surface of a human body, and the surface of the Chinese medicinal patch is coated with Chinese medicinal ointment, so that different Chinese medicinal formulas can be selected according to different symptoms. When the conductive gel sheet 20 is attached to the body surface of the patient, the Chinese medicine patch 30 is applied to the body surface of the patient, so that the Chinese medicine paste can directly act on the focus position.
An electrode member 40 is disposed on the top surface of the substrate 10, and the electrode member 40 is in electrical contact with the conductive gel sheet 20. The electrode member 40 is a metal or other conductive material component that can be connected to a power source or controller and functions to transmit externally input current to the conductive gel sheet 20, and in particular applications, the frequency, intensity, duration, etc. of the current can be adjusted as desired.
The application method of the composite electric stimulation physiotherapy sheet provided by the utility model is briefly described below.
The physiotherapy sheet is taken out from the packaging bag, and the protective film is removed. The corresponding Chinese medicinal paste is added to the Chinese medicinal patch 30. The physiotherapy sheet is attached to the part of the patient to be treated, so that the traditional Chinese medicine patch 30 is attached to the body surface of the patient. The electrode assembly 40 on the patch is then connected to an external power source or controller. And setting proper current parameters according to the condition and the doctor's advice of the patient, and starting a physiotherapy mode. In the physiotherapy process, the reaction of the patient is observed, and if the patient is uncomfortable, the physiotherapy is regulated or stopped in time. After the physiotherapy is finished, the physiotherapy sheet is removed from the body surface of the patient, and the traditional Chinese medicine patch 30 is discarded. Cleaning and sterilizing the physiotherapy sheet, and placing the physiotherapy sheet back into a packaging bag, and storing the physiotherapy sheet in a dry and cool place for the next use.

In one embodiment of the present utility model, the composite electro-stimulation therapy sheet further includes a release film 50, and the release film 50 is attached to the conductive gel sheet 20 and can be removed.
The release film 50 is a material such as plastic, paper, etc. that can prevent the conductive gel sheet 20 from adhering to other objects. The release film 50 has the function of protecting the surface of the conductive gel sheet 20 from being polluted or damaged, prolonging the service life of the conductive gel sheet, and meanwhile, the release film 50 is added to facilitate the preservation and carrying of the physiotherapy sheet, so that the use convenience is improved. When the physiotherapy sheet is needed, the release film 50 is only required to be removed from the conductive gel sheet 20, and the physiotherapy sheet is convenient to use.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, the base 10 includes two circular base parts 101, and the two circular base parts 101 are connected by a connection part 103. That is, the base 10 is composed of two circular base portions 101 of the same or different sizes and shapes. The connecting part 103 and the round base part 101 are made of non-woven fabrics or other flexible materials, and have certain elasticity and ductility, so that the physiotherapy sheet can adapt to different body surface curved surfaces and muscle distribution.
The number of the conductive gel sheets 20 and the number of the traditional Chinese medicine patches 30 are two, the two conductive gel sheets 20 are in one-to-one correspondence with the two circular base parts 101, each conductive gel sheet 20 is attached to the bottom surface of the corresponding circular base part 101, and each traditional Chinese medicine patch 30 is arranged in the hollow area H20 of the corresponding conductive gel sheet 20. The two conductive gel sheets 20 and the Chinese medicine patches 30 are adopted, in use, the two conductive gel sheets 20 can be respectively attached to two parts of a patient to be treated, so that the two Chinese medicine patches 30 are respectively attached to two parts of the patient.
The compound electric stimulation physiotherapy sheet provided by the embodiment can realize simultaneous treatment of two different parts, and improves the treatment efficiency and effect. Meanwhile, the connecting part 103 can enable the physiotherapy sheet to adapt to different body surface curved surfaces and muscle distribution, and the application range and flexibility of the physiotherapy sheet are increased.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, the connecting portion 103 is provided with a tear seam 102 for tearing the connecting portion 103, so that the two substrate 10 portions are separated from each other and independent. Tear seam 102 is a weakened area, such as a discontinuous cut, groove, etc., that can facilitate tearing of the connecting portion 103. The tear 102 serves to tear the connecting portion 103 as required so that the two circular base portions 101 are separated from each other and independent.
The number of the electrode pieces 40 is two, the two electrode pieces 40 are in one-to-one correspondence with the two conductive gel sheets 20, and each electrode piece 40 is in electrical contact with a corresponding conductive gel sheet 20.
In use, the physiotherapy sheet can be torn from the tearing mark 102 to form two independent physiotherapy sheets according to the requirement, and the two independent physiotherapy sheets can be independently used, so that the use is more flexible and convenient. Of course, the two physiotherapy sheets can be unfolded and attached to the body surface of the patient at a certain angle according to the need when in use, and the two physiotherapy sheets can be torn away from the tearing trace 102 for a certain distance, but still keep the two physiotherapy sheets in a connected state. In this way, the flexibility and adaptability of its use are significantly improved.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, the patch 30 includes a bottom sheet 301 and a medicine storage ring 302, the bottom sheet 301 is made of a non-woven fabric material, and a ring of adhesive layer is disposed on the top surface of the bottom sheet 301, and the adhesive layer is adhered to the bottom surface of the substrate 10. A drug storage ring 302 is adhered to the center of the bottom sheet 301 and is adapted to carry a Chinese medicinal ointment.
In this embodiment, the patch 30 is composed of a backsheet 301 and a drug storage ring 302, wherein the backsheet 301 is a nonwoven material. The top surface of the backsheet 301 is provided with a ring of adhesive layer, which is a material that can adhere to the bottom surface of the substrate 10, such as glue, tape, etc. The adhesive layer is used for fixing the Chinese medicinal patch 30 in the hollow region H20 of the substrate 10 and keeping its position unchanged. A drug storage ring 302 is adhered to the center of the base sheet 301. The drug storage ring 302 is a circular or other shaped structure, such as plastic, foam, etc., which can hold a traditional Chinese medicine ointment. The function of the drug storage ring 302 is to store the chinese medicine paste therein and isolate it from the conductive gel sheet 20. The combined structure of the bottom plate 301 and the medicine storage ring 302 facilitates the accommodation of the Chinese medicine paste, the replacement of the Chinese medicine paste 30 and the use convenience.
Advantageously, a waterproof barrier film 303 is provided in the drug storage ring 302, which is adhered to the bottom sheet 301, and the waterproof barrier film 303 is a material that can prevent the passage of moisture and other liquids, such as a plastic film, etc., so that the penetration of the Chinese medicine paste to the side of the base 10 can be prevented.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, the electrode assembly 40 includes an electrode post 401, a contact piece 402, an electrode button 403, and a blocking piece 404, wherein the contact piece 402 is fixed at the lower end of the electrode post 401 and is located below the substrate 10 and is electrically contacted with the conductive gel sheet 20.
The electrode button 403 is positioned at the top of the electrode column 401 and is suitable for being magnetically connected with the lead wire connector; the baffle 404 is disposed on the electrode column 401 and between the contact piece 402 and the electrode button 403, and the baffle 404 stops above the substrate 10.
The electrode member 40 is entirely made of a metal conductive material. The electrode column 401 is a cylindrical member made of metal or other conductive material, and functions to connect the contact piece 402, the electrode button 403, and the blocking piece 404, and to transmit electric current. The contact strip 402 is a circular or other shaped sheet of metal or other conductive material that is operative to electrically contact the conductive gel strip 20 and to transmit electrical current to the conductive gel strip 20. The electrode button 403 is a ball-like structure made of metal or other conductive material, and is magnetically connected to the lead wire connector, and receives or outputs current from the lead wire connector. The lead wire connector is a component which can be connected with an external power supply or a controller, and a magnet or other magnetic materials are arranged in the lead wire connector and can be magnetically connected with the electrode buckle 403. The baffle 404 is a circular or other shaped sheet of plastic or other material that functions to prevent the electrode assembly 40 from falling off the substrate 10.
Preferably, the conductive gel sheet 20 contains antimicrobial nano silver. In addition to mixing the conductive powder with the gel, a certain amount of nano-silver may be added in the manufacture of the conductive gel sheet 20. The nano silver is a nano material with antibacterial property, and can kill or inhibit the growth of microorganisms such as bacteria, fungi, viruses and the like. The nano silver has the function of improving the antibacterial performance of the conductive gel sheet 20 and preventing the problems of infection and the like in the physiotherapy process.
